Thesis: The strong growth in digital banking adoption and the potential for improved net interest margins are driving a more optimistic outlook for TTB.
1TTB's digital banking user base has grown by 40% YoY, enhancing customer engagement and reducing operational costs.
2The bank's net interest margin is expected to improve by 50 basis points due to anticipated rate hikes by the Bank of Thailand.
3The bank plans to launch a new suite of SME lending products aimed at capturing a growing market segment, targeting a 15% market share within 2 years.
